А. С. Белый is a scholar working on Catalysis, Materials Chemistry and Inorganic Chemistry. According to data from OpenAlex, А. С. Белый has authored 101 papers receiving a total of 551 indexed citations (citations by other indexed papers that have themselves been cited), including 69 papers in Catalysis, 61 papers in Materials Chemistry and 58 papers in Inorganic Chemistry. Recurrent topics in А. С. Белый's work include Catalysis and Oxidation Reactions (57 papers), Catalytic Processes in Materials Science (55 papers) and Zeolite Catalysis and Synthesis (55 papers). А. С. Белый is often cited by papers focused on Catalysis and Oxidation Reactions (57 papers), Catalytic Processes in Materials Science (55 papers) and Zeolite Catalysis and Synthesis (55 papers). А. С. Белый collaborates with scholars based in Russia and United States. А. С. Белый's co-authors include М. Д. Смоликов, V. K. Duplyakin, T. I. Gulyaeva, А. Н. Загоруйко, А. С. Носков, В. А. Дроздов, E. A. Paukshtis, В. А. Лихолобов, A. I. Nizovskiĭ and E. A. Paukshtis and has published in prestigious journals such as Industrial & Engineering Chemistry Research, Catalysis Today and The International Journal of Advanced Manufacturing Technology.
